Glasgow's Talon sinks claws into Glenrothes IT business

Talon has been expanding since it was acquired by technology sector entrepreneur Tom O’Hara’s Kick ICT Group two years ago.

The acquisition of Vozero, which is for an undisclosed sum, will add a further £500,000 or so of fee income and strengthens Talon’s position as one of Scotland’s key suppliers of Microsoft business applications, cloud infrastructure and consultancy.
